Place Juliette Greco is a historical landmark that captures the essence of Parisian culture and history. Named after the iconic French singer and actress, this charming square is a tribute to the arts and the vibrant life that flourished in the city during the mid-20th century. As you arrive, you will be greeted by a beautiful open space adorned with lush greenery and cozy benches, inviting you to sit back and immerse yourself in the local atmosphere. The square is surrounded by quaint cafes and bistros where you can indulge in delightful French pastries or enjoy a warm cup of coffee while watching the world go by. The location is steeped in artistic significance, often frequented by musicians, poets, and artists who find inspiration in its serene environment. Place Juliette Greco is not only a place to relax but also a spot where history comes alive, making it an essential stop on your Parisian adventure. Don't miss the chance to capture stunning photographs of this picturesque square, especially in the early morning or late afternoon when the sunlight bathes the area in a golden hue. As a historical landmark, it serves as a reminder of the cultural richness of Paris and the artistry that continues to thrive here.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you're driving, enter the address '75006 Paris' into your GPS. Place Juliette Greco is located in the heart of the 6th arrondissement of Paris. Depending on your starting point, you may take the Périphérique (ring road) and exit at Porte de Saint-Germain. Follow the signs to the city center, and once you’re near Boulevard Saint-Germain, look for Rue de l'Odéon. Parking in the area is limited; consider using a nearby public parking garage such as Parking Saint-Germain or Parking Odéon, which may cost around €2-€4 per hour.

  • Metro

    To reach Place Juliette Greco via public transportation, take Paris Metro Line 4 (the purple line) to the Odéon station. After exiting the train, follow the signs to Rue de l'Odéon. Upon reaching the street, you can walk to the square, which is just a short distance away. Make sure to check the Paris Metro schedule and purchase a single ticket for €1.90.

  • Bus

    Another public transport option is to take the bus. You can catch bus line 58, which stops at the Odéon - Luxembourg station. From there, it’s a short walk to Place Juliette Greco. A single bus ticket costs €1.90, and tickets can be purchased from ticket machines at bus stops or directly from the driver.

  • RER

    If you're coming from the suburbs, you might consider taking the RER (the regional train). Take the RER B to Saint-Michel - Notre-Dame station. From there, transfer to Metro Line 4 at the Saint-Michel station and head towards Odéon. This journey may take about 30-40 minutes total, including transfers, and the RER ticket price will depend on your starting location, typically ranging from €3.80 to €10.
